Handbook of Nanomaterials for Cancer Theranostics focuses on recent developments in advanced theranostic nanomedicines from a chemical and biological perspective where the advantages of theranostics are achieved by combining multiple components. The authors explore the pros and cons of theranostic nanomaterials developed in cancer research in the last 15 years, with the different strategies compared and scrutinized. In addition, the book explores how nanomaterials may overcome the regulatory hurdles facing theranostic nanomedicines.

This is an important research reference for postgraduates and researchers in nanomedicine and cancer research who want to learn more on how nanomaterials can help create more effective cancer treatments.

  • Highlights the development of smart theranostic nanomaterials to tackle biomedical problems in cancer therapy and diagnostics
  • Explores the regulatory hurdles facing theranostic nanomedicine
  • Discusses how the use of nanomaterials can help create more effective cancer treatments
